In a final year project (FYP) or dissertation, crafting the introduction is crucial as it sets the stage by explaining the rationale behind your research. The introduction not only introduces your topic but also articulates the significance of your study, laying out the context, objectives, and the problem your research aims to address. This workshop is designed to provide you with a clear structure for writing a compelling introduction, guiding you through the process of answering key questions such as: 

- What is the background of your research? 

- Why is your study important? 

- What are the specific aims and objectives of your work? 

- How does your research contribute to the existing body of knowledge? 

By addressing these questions, you’ll be able to construct an introduction that effectively frames your research, engages your readers, and provides a strong foundation for the rest of your dissertation.
